#d9a54e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9a54e is composed of 85.1% red, 64.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 37.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 57.8%. #d9a54e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#b34b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#d9a54e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d9a54e has RGB values of R:217, G:165,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.64,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14263630.

Shades and Tints of #d9a54e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fcf7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9a54e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979490 is the less saturated color, while #faad2d is the most saturated one.
